QUESTION

What is the correct breastfeeding teaching to prevent nipple trauma during latch-on?

Tap card or press Space to flip

ANSWER

Ensure a deep latch with lips flanged and areola in mouth. A deep latch ensures effective milk removal and minimizes nipple compression injury.
